Justice Department Releases Investigative Findings on the City of Miami Police Department and Officer-involved Shootings

Washington, DC–(ENEWSPF)–July 9, 2013.  Following a comprehensive investigation, the Justice Department today released its letter of findings determining that the city of Miami Police Department (MPD) has engaged in a pattern or practice of excessive use of force through officer-involved shootings in violation of the Fourth Amendment of the Constitution. [Read More…]
